What they do
A Surgical Technician or Technologist assists with surgical operations. Prepares the operating room and equipment before a procedure, and helps surgeons and nurses during the procedure. Works in hospitals or other healthcare facilities.

Job Description
To assist surgical team at the Cardiovascular Center operating rooms during operative procedures, by preparing sterile equipment for the operation and passing instruments, sponges and sutures to the operating team. Assist with inventory, sterilization of instruments, prepare and select equipment for procedures, transfer of patients as needed, turnover and transfer of instruments to CSR/Decontamination and putting equipment back in place.
